Formal Verification of Hardware

study guides for every class

that actually explain what's on your next test

Power optimization

from class:

Formal Verification of Hardware

Definition

Power optimization refers to the techniques and strategies used to minimize the power consumption of hardware systems while maintaining their performance and functionality. This is crucial in the design of integrated circuits and digital systems, where power efficiency is directly linked to battery life, heat dissipation, and overall system reliability. Effective power optimization can lead to significant improvements in energy efficiency, which is increasingly important in today's technology-driven world.

congrats on reading the definition of power optimization.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Power optimization is essential for battery-operated devices, as it directly affects battery life and device usability.
  2. There are various strategies for power optimization, including static and dynamic techniques that target different sources of power consumption.
  3. Power optimization can be implemented at various design levels, from high-level architectural decisions down to low-level transistor design.
  4. Effective power optimization not only reduces energy consumption but also minimizes heat generation, which can improve the reliability of hardware components.
  5. The trade-off between performance and power consumption is a critical consideration in the design process, often requiring careful analysis to achieve the desired balance.

Review Questions

  • How do different power optimization techniques impact the performance of hardware systems?
    • Different power optimization techniques can significantly affect hardware performance. For example, dynamic voltage scaling may lower the voltage during less intensive tasks to save energy but could result in slower processing speeds. Clock gating disables sections of a circuit when not in use, which can help save power without affecting overall performance too much. It's essential for designers to carefully evaluate these trade-offs to maintain an efficient balance between power savings and system performance.
  • Compare and contrast dynamic voltage scaling and clock gating as methods for achieving power optimization in digital circuits.
    • Dynamic voltage scaling (DVS) adjusts the voltage and frequency according to workload requirements, allowing processors to operate efficiently under varying loads. In contrast, clock gating selectively turns off the clock signal to inactive parts of a circuit, reducing unnecessary switching activity and saving dynamic power. While DVS focuses on adjusting operational conditions based on real-time demands, clock gating targets specific sections of a circuit that are not currently needed, making both techniques complementary in optimizing overall power consumption.
  • Evaluate the impact of power optimization strategies on the design process of integrated circuits in modern computing devices.
    • Power optimization strategies play a crucial role in the design process of integrated circuits, especially as devices become more compact and powerful. The need for enhanced battery life and reduced heat generation pushes designers to integrate these strategies early in the design phase. By employing low-power design techniques and balancing performance with efficiency, engineers can create systems that meet the demands of modern applications while adhering to energy standards. The evaluation of these strategies can lead to innovations in circuit architecture that drive advancements in technology and sustainability.

"Power optimization" also found in:

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ides